Hi All, I've got the hang of creating vcd's from mpeg files with Easy..5.0, and as far as I can see I'm creating all the necessary menu pages but the menus do not show up in my (new Panasonic) DVD/VCD player. What am I missing? The thing scoots through the different play sequences I create, just no menus showing up. I'm a bit of a newbie at this, so bear with! thanks, john t.

It's not a bug. The default for how long your menu should show is 0. So it will show for the frame length of your menu and then start your first clip. If your using a 1 frame (like a jpg) menu background then your menu will only show for 1/30th of 1 second. Change the wait or loop settings to set how long you want the menu to show before starting the movie.
